The Secret Sauce: Differentiated Instruction

The magic ingredient is called differentiated instruction. Sounds fancy, right? But it simply means teaching kids in a way that fits their individual needs. Imagine a chef making a special dish for each guest based on their preferences and dietary restrictions. That's Achieve3000 in a nutshell, but instead of risotto, it's reading comprehension. No more force-feeding everyone the same bland intellectual mush!

The brilliance lies in how it's delivered. Kids aren't just passively reading dry text. They're diving into current events – real-world stories about everything from space exploration to celebrity antics (yes, even the juicy stuff!). And here's the kicker: these stories are adjusted to each student's reading level. A struggling reader gets the same fascinating news, but written in a way they can actually understand. A more advanced reader gets the same story, but with more complex vocabulary and deeper analysis.
